[问题]/boot分区太大,如何调整不损失XP的数据?

系统安装、升级讨论
版面规则
我们都知道新人的确很菜,也喜欢抱怨,并且带有浓厚的Windows习惯,但既然在这里询问,我们就应该有责任帮助他们解决问题,而不是直接泼冷水、简单的否定或发表对解决问题没有任何帮助的帖子。乐于分享,以人为本,这正是Ubuntu的精神所在。
回复
myg8627
帖子: 27
注册时间: 2008-01-01 20:56

[问题]/boot分区太大,如何调整不损失XP的数据?

#1

帖子 myg8627 » 2008-04-30 16:10

用WUBI装的8.04,但是现在发现/BOOT太大,其他的分区也都吃紧了
搜索了一下没找到解决方法,是不是挂载到/HOME就可以了?
附件
Screenshot.jpg
头像
kg7726
帖子: 402
注册时间: 2006-12-16 12:39
来自: 广东省广州市

#2

帖子 kg7726 » 2008-04-30 19:30

:em25 你的boot分区是独立的?
如果boot不是独立的分区应该不会有什么影响的
头像
spider5
帖子: 351
注册时间: 2005-12-15 21:52

#3

帖子 spider5 » 2008-04-30 20:13

myg8627 写了:用WUBI装的8.04,但是现在发现/BOOT太大,其他的分区也都吃紧了
搜索了一下没找到解决方法,是不是挂载到/HOME就可以了?
惊!!!第一次看见有人把/boot设置得比/还大的。而且你的/boot分区怎么会是无类型呢?
楼主可以用fdisk -l看一下,/和/boot在物理盘符上是不是紧挨着的,如果是就简单了。用gparted(就是安装是给你分区的那个工具)执行大小调整操作,把多余的空间划回根分区就可以了,一般/boot保留<1G就可以了。

如果不是,比较麻烦。
在grub选第二项进failsafe模式。
umount /boot。
不能挂/home(你已经占用了),挂个/mnt/disk或者其他目录。
然后把文件移动到现在的/boot下(其实是/分区的一块)
改fstab,改/boot/grub/menu.lst,释放后的空间可以合到其他节点下,或者独立也行。(/怎么也得给个5G吧,10g也不多,/home都是你自己的东西,应该最大)
标红色的操作比较容易出错,最好找版上的大牛(zhuqin、ee、bigsnake等)问清楚。

还是挺麻烦的,有不对或者遗漏之处楼下继续补充。
myg8627
帖子: 27
注册时间: 2008-01-01 20:56

#4

帖子 myg8627 » 2008-04-30 22:31

spider5 写了:
myg8627 写了:用WUBI装的8.04,但是现在发现/BOOT太大,其他的分区也都吃紧了
搜索了一下没找到解决方法,是不是挂载到/HOME就可以了?
惊!!!第一次看见有人把/boot设置得比/还大的。而且你的/boot分区怎么会是无类型呢?
楼主可以用fdisk -l看一下,/和/boot在物理盘符上是不是紧挨着的,如果是就简单了。用gparted(就是安装是给你分区的那个工具)执行大小调整操作,把多余的空间划回根分区就可以了,一般/boot保留<1G就可以了。

如果不是,比较麻烦。
在grub选第二项进failsafe模式。
umount /boot。
不能挂/home(你已经占用了),挂个/mnt/disk或者其他目录。
然后把文件移动到现在的/boot下(其实是/分区的一块)
改fstab,改/boot/grub/menu.lst,释放后的空间可以合到其他节点下,或者独立也行。(/怎么也得给个5G吧,10g也不多,/home都是你自己的东西,应该最大)
标红色的操作比较容易出错,最好找版上的大牛(zhuqin、ee、bigsnake等)问清楚。

还是挺麻烦的,有不对或者遗漏之处楼下继续补充。
汗~```
我是在XP下WUBI装的,怎么分也没有提示的,盘符信息现在看不懂了
Disk /dev/sda: 120.0 GB, 120034123776 bytes
240 heads, 63 sectors/track, 15505 cylinders
Units = cylinders of 15120 * 512 = 7741440 bytes
Disk identifier: 0x423b423a

Device Boot Start End Blocks Id System
/dev/sda1 * 1 3101 23443528+ c W95 FAT32 (LBA)
/dev/sda2 3102 15505 93774240 f W95 Ext'd (LBA)
/dev/sda5 3102 5814 20510248+ b W95 FAT32
/dev/sda6 5815 8527 20510248+ b W95 FAT32
/dev/sda7 8528 11240 20510248+ b W95 FAT32
/dev/sda8 11241 15505 32243368+ 7 HPFS/NTFS
myg8627
帖子: 27
注册时间: 2008-01-01 20:56

#5

帖子 myg8627 » 2008-04-30 22:45

用GPARTED看分区,有些问题
附件
Screenshot.jpg
myg8627
帖子: 27
注册时间: 2008-01-01 20:56

#6

帖子 myg8627 » 2008-04-30 22:45

用GPARTED看分区,有些问题
附件
Screenshot.jpg
头像
spider5
帖子: 351
注册时间: 2005-12-15 21:52

#7

帖子 spider5 » 2008-05-04 20:48

不是这样看的,在ubuntu里面看,(也要在ubuntu里调整吧),grub进failsafe,然后用文本模式的gparted。也许图形方式下也可以?没试过。注意是把/boot保留后面的空间,腾出前面与/合并。
你的linux占的空间应该是sda8,汗,几个分区加起来大小超过ntfs的计算容量。wubi用了LVPM(Loopmounted Virtual Partition Manager)分区技术,只有进ubuntu后才能看出linux style的分区大小和顺序。
头像
gmagogsfm
帖子: 129
注册时间: 2008-03-06 21:32

Re: [问题]/boot分区太大,如何调整不损失XP的数据?

#8

帖子 gmagogsfm » 2008-05-04 21:29

myg8627 写了:用WUBI装的8.04,但是现在发现/BOOT太大,其他的分区也都吃紧了
搜索了一下没找到解决方法,是不是挂载到/HOME就可以了?
有个疑问……
为什么boot一共19G只剩下6G,放了什么东西……好恐怖
回复